Output 329af839a386b8c233cf0e8c8ef531fe7197637e669cd8fe4b005bb82c7c9fc9:1

value
23038622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a84fb0acd5b7629fba7ffe3aa7b06d79bb2fac9a OP_EQUAL
address
MPF7DdET382MYvectdabioxvXCxgHEbtW5
transaction
329af839a386b8c233cf0e8c8ef531fe7197637e669cd8fe4b005bb82c7c9fc9
spent
true